3) Heap-based buffer overflow

EUVDB-ID: #VU81865

Risk: High

CVSSv3.1: 7.9 [CVSS:3.1/AV:N/AC:L/PR:N/UI:R/S:U/C:H/I:H/A:H/E:P/RL:O/RC:C]

CVE-ID: CVE-2023-38545

CWE-ID: CWE-122 - Heap-based Buffer Overflow

Exploit availability: Yes

Description

The vulnerability allows a remote attacker to execute arbitrary code on the target system.

The vulnerability exists due to a boundary error in the SOCKS5 proxy handshake. A remote attacker can trick the victim to visit a malicious website, trigger a heap-based buffer overflow and execute arbitrary code on the target system.

Successful exploitation of this vulnerability may result in complete compromise of vulnerable system but requires that SOCKS5 proxy is used and that SOCKS5 handshake is slow (e.g. under heavy load or DoS attack).

5) External control of file name or path

EUVDB-ID: #VU81863

Risk: Low

CVSSv3.1: 2.3 [CVSS:3.1/AV:N/AC:H/PR:L/UI:R/S:U/C:N/I:L/A:N/E:U/RL:O/RC:C]

CVE-ID: CVE-2023-38546

CWE-ID: CWE-73 - External Control of File Name or Path

Exploit availability: No

Description

The vulnerability allows an attacker to inject arbitrary cookies into request.

The vulnerability exists due to the way cookies are handled by libcurl. If a transfer has cookies enabled when the handle is duplicated, the cookie-enable state is also cloned - but without cloning the actual cookies. If the source handle did not read any cookies from a specific file on disk, the cloned version of the handle would instead store the file name as none (using the four ASCII letters, no quotes).

Subsequent use of the cloned handle that does not explicitly set a source to load cookies from would then inadvertently load cookies from a file named none - if such a file exists and is readable in the current directory of the program using libcurl.

11) Type confusion

EUVDB-ID: #VU85668

Risk: Critical

CVSSv3.1: 8.4 [CVSS:3.1/AV:N/AC:L/PR:N/UI:R/S:U/C:H/I:H/A:H/E:H/RL:O/RC:C]

CVE-ID: CVE-2024-23222

CWE-ID: CWE-843 - Type confusion

Exploit availability: No

Description

The vulnerability allows a remote attacker to execute arbitrary code on the target system.

The vulnerability exists due to a type confusion error when processing HTML content. A remote attacker can trick the victim to open a specially crafted website, trigger a type confusion error and execute arbitrary code on the target system.

Successful exploitation of this vulnerability may result in complete compromise of vulnerable system.

Note, the vulnerability is being actively exploited in the wild.
